> >Does Fedora Directory Server support account inactivation to provide 
> >flexibility to temporarily disable user access?
> >  
> >
> Yes.  In the console, in the Directory window in the 
> Directory tab (the directory browser), you can select a user 
> and select inactivate (or re-activate if already inactive) 
> from the menu.

Note also that you can inactivate whole groups of people by inactivating a
role.
